Dichotomous keys are the tools which is used by the  non-expert users to identify organisms by directing them to look at the known, important organisms.

The non expert individuals does not know how to distinguish between  different species of pine trees, a dichotomous key arrives at the answer to species identification by presenting a series of questions with two possible answers.

<u>Dichotomous keys </u>are most often used for identifying plant and animal species based on their characteristics.This key also helps identifying, whether an organism belongs to a particular closely related group of organisms or  a separate species of organism.

It helps one analyze the traits of an organism, and based on their characteristics, and classify the species of the object or organism.
